Rebrand project to vintner

Renamed the GitHub repo, Go module path, binary, and default install
directory from msvc-go-wine to vintner. Updated every user-facing
string (usage text, error prefixes, README, LICENSE, CI/release
workflow) and the embedded compatibility patches' own header text to
match; the VINTNER_LANG env var replaces VSMC_GO_WINE_LANG.

Also fixes a real bug found while re-verifying the rename end-to-end:
Microsoft.Cpp.WindowsSDK.props.patch had LF-only line endings in its
hunk body while the real Microsoft-shipped file it targets is CRLF,
so `git apply` silently failed on every real install and the SDK
detection fix it's meant to provide was never actually taking effect.
Restored matching CRLF endings in the hunk (checked against the other
five patches, which already had this right). Left the patch's
internal MsvcGoWine_ExtraSdkRoots MSBuild property name alone rather
than renaming it too - changing hunk content, even just an identifier,
breaks reverse-apply idempotency for anyone re-running download
against an already-patched tree, which the fix above depends on. Added
a .remove marker so an existing install's old-named props file gets
cleaned up on the next download.

Re-verified end-to-end after the rename: general MSBuild/cl/link
still work, and a real KMDF driver build (compile, link, INF stamping,
Inf2Cat signability check) still succeeds under the renamed binary.

README also gets an accuracy pass: WDK support and the download/env
CLI flags it lists were out of date (WDK was previously listed under
"Known gaps" despite being implemented and verified), the full tool
list was missing mc/cmd/findstr, and the new command aliases and
VINTNER_LANG option are now documented.
